Independence Power Holdings, Inc. is engaged in the deployment and operational management of a fleet of 101 modified containerized Battery Energy Storage System (BESS) units acquired from GridCore. The company operates through wholly owned subsidiaries including DBD Express and Kyma Batteries, providing asset management services for the BESS fleet under commercial agreements. It utilizes an embedded operating system and software platform to manage operations at centralized battery rental yards and field sites. The company also maintains administrative services agreements with related parties to support staffing, payroll, accounting, and other administrative functions. Additionally, it leases property in Wisconsin for warehouse, research and development, and office use. The company reported fiscal year 2025 revenue of approximately $97.2 million and maintains a strong liquidity position with a current ratio of 17.38 as of December 31, 2025. TriUnity Business Services Limited, a Nevada corporation and subsidiary, provides business administration services such as accounting, human resources management, payroll, and head-hunting primarily in Malaysia, with reported revenues of $333 and a net loss of $10,206 for the three months ended October 31, 2025.

- Independence Power Holdings, Inc. operates through wholly owned subsidiaries including DBD Express and Kyma Batteries, focusing on deployment and operational management of a fleet of 101 modified containerized Battery Energy Storage System (BESS) units acquired from GridCore [S1].
- The company provides asset management services for the BESS fleet under an Asset Management Agreement with cooperative parties, utilizing an embedded operating system and software platform for centralized battery rental yards and field sites [S1].
- Independence Power has administrative services agreements with related parties, including IPAS Asset Management, which provides staffing, payroll, accounting, and other administrative services under a cost-plus nominal fee arrangement [S1].
- The company leases property in Wisconsin for warehouse, R&D, and office space under a commercial lease with related parties [S1].
- Financial snapshot as of December 31, 2025: total assets of approximately $92.8 million, including current assets of $24.6 million and other assets of $67.6 million; total liabilities of $19.4 million, including current liabilities of $1.4 million and deferred tax liability of $17.9 million [S1].
- Revenue for the fiscal year ended December 31, 2025 was approximately $97.2 million [S1].
- Net income for the quarter ended October 31, 2025 was a loss of $10,206 [S2].
- Basic and diluted earnings per share for the fiscal year ended December 31, 2025 were $0.31 [S1].
- Liquidity ratios as of December 31, 2025 show a current ratio of 17.38, indicating strong short-term liquidity, though cash and equivalents were not separately disclosed [S1].
- The company has related party transactions governed by a formal policy reviewed by the Audit Committee, including management and consulting agreements and administrative services agreements [S1].
- TriUnity Business Services Limited, a Nevada corporation, provides business administration services such as accounting, bookkeeping, human resources management, payroll, head-hunting, and administrative support primarily in Malaysia, with revenues of $333 for the three months ended October 31, 2025 and net loss of $10,206 for the same period [S2].
- TriUnity Business Services Limited had total assets of $12,055 and total liabilities of $36,336 as of October 31, 2025, with accumulated deficit of $56,911 [S2].
- TriUnity Business Services Limited's revenue is generated from human resources and administrative support services, with a single reportable segment based on business administration services and Malaysia geography [S2].
- Major customers for TriUnity Business Services Limited accounted for significant portions of revenue, with Customer C representing 75% of revenues for the three months ended October 31, 2025 [S2].
